After the UCP
GANG:
Want to thank all of you that came to the "Ultimate Corvette Party" yesterday and hope you all had a good time. We admit parking has always been a problem at the show for the public. We have tried and tried everything and nothing seems to work. The Police yesterday gave wrong directions to people. Our signage was some what confusing, but for those of you that have been to the show for a few years, know we are improving every year.
We at TBV meet next month and discuss our concerns, and then work on them for the following year. I was there a 4:30am and til 6:00pm and talked to as many people as I could for input and I know I had alot of good response came that we have improved. I promise TBV will work on the public parking for next year as an issue. The photo guy also slowed down things a tat in the morning, but all of you were very patient and we really appreciated that.
The vendors loved and praised our new location for them. Food tent "went faster than last year and Show parking went generaly smooth. Again, thank you for coming and if you had any concerns, PM me and I will add to our list for next year. (Give us your concerns and possible solutions).
For the record, we estimated 410 car in the show, 25 more with vendor Corvettes and Police guessed at 500 spectators.
WE WILL BE BIGGER AND BETTER NEXT YEAR"
